Outside the private room, the roar of voices surged like a tidal sea.

The central hall on the second floor of the Myriad Treasures Pavilion was an enormous stone-gambling arena.

Three thousand pearl lamps hung from the vaulted ceiling, pouring down cascades of light that drove away every inch of shadow.

The stands teemed with people. Countless bloodshot eyes stared fixedly at the "blind boxes" wrapped in stone skins at the center of the arena.

Ye Xingchen walked ahead with his hands clasped behind his back, his steps as leisurely as though he were strolling through his own backyard.

Zuo Tianhe and his daughter followed close behind, their expressions tense.

Behind them came three stone-appraising masters.

They had barely turned past the corridor when they ran headlong into another group.

"Oh? Isn't this Brother Zuo?"

A mocking, strangely inflected voice rang out.

The middle-aged man at the head of the group wore brocade robes and had a ruddy complexion. He was Shen Wanshan, head of the Shen Clan and the Left Clan's sworn enemy.

Behind Shen Wanshan, aside from several Shen Clan elders, the most eye-catching figure was someone entirely shrouded in a voluminous black robe.

The person was hunched over as if carrying a mountain on his back, not a single inch of skin exposed.

As he walked, a layer of white frost rapidly spread over the red carpet beneath his feet, and the originally sweltering air around him plunged to freezing point.

Zuo Tianhe abruptly stopped, forcing the words out through clenched teeth. "Netherworld... an evil cultivator?"

The Netherworld of Central Province employed exceedingly bizarre methods. They dealt with corpses and yin baleful energy all year round, and it was said they could commune with ghosts and gods.

Ye Xingchen raised an eyebrow slightly at this.

Netherworld?

He quietly circulated the Origin Heaven Art, and a flash of violet flickered deep within his eyes.

In his vision, that black-robed man was no living person at all.

He was clearly a long-dried husk. What flowed through his body was not blood, but a viscous blackish-green liquid.

Beneath that hood, two balls of ghostly green fire danced within his eye sockets, exuding a nauseating stench of decay.

Interesting. Ye Xingchen thought. They even invited this half-human, half-ghost thing. It seems the Shen Clan is determined to win this time.

Shen Wanshan had already approached. His gaze swept over the Left Clan members before finally settling on Zuo Tianhe's taut face, and his smile grew even brighter.

"Brother Zuo, I heard that old ancestor of yours is nearly done for?"

"If you fail to gamble out that legendary Innate Spiritual Milk this time, I'm afraid you'll have to start preparing the funeral."

"Oh, do be sure to notify me when the time comes. Shen will certainly bring a generous gift."

His words were vicious beyond measure, like stabbing a knife straight into the Left Clan's hearts.

Zuo Xiaoqing was so furious that even her hands trembled. Had the occasion not been unsuitable, she would have thrown a punch long ago.

Zuo Tianhe drew a deep breath, forcibly suppressing the rage in his heart. "No need for Brother Shen's concern. The Left Clan's sky will not fall. As for Brother Shen, you have committed every evil under heaven. Aren't you afraid that retribution will one day strike, leaving you without sons or descendants?"

"Hahaha! Retribution?"

Shen Wanshan threw back his head and laughed as if he had heard the greatest joke in the world.

"In this world, strength is the law of heaven! Zuo Tianhe, you should worry about yourself instead. If you lose today, Azure Cloud City will no longer have anyone named Zuo!"

The two sides stood with swords drawn and bows bent, the air thick with the smell of gunpowder.

The black-robed man slightly raised his head. An ear-grating scraping sound came from beneath his hood, like two rusted iron sheets grinding against each other. "The scent of the living... is delicious."

The two ghostly flames pierced through the hood and fixed directly on Ye Xingchen.

It felt as though a cold, wet venomous snake had crawled down his spine.

Zuo Xiaoqing's soul stirred violently, and her face turned deathly pale.

The next instant, a warm hand rested on her shoulder.

Ye Xingchen stood before her, blocking that venomous gaze. "Since you're dead, you should lie obediently in your coffin. Running out to scare people is where you went wrong."

As his words fell, he flicked his fingertip.

A wisp of Chaos energy, imperceptible to ordinary people, shot forth.

"Hiss—!"

A shrill scream suddenly rang out from beneath the black robe. The two ghostly flames trembled violently, as though they had encountered their natural predator, and instantly shrank deep into the eye sockets.

The black-robed man staggered back three steps, and two charred footprints were corroded into the red carpet beneath his feet.

The entire venue fell silent.

The smile on Shen Wanshan's face froze.

Zhang Sanqian and the other two masters abruptly looked up, staring at Ye Xingchen in disbelief.

What had just happened?

"Let's go."

Ye Xingchen withdrew his hand without even glancing at the black-robed man. He headed straight for the core area. "Don't let this corpse stench ruin the mood."

After passing through the outer area, the group stepped into the "Primordial Stone Zone."

The atmosphere here was completely different.

There was no clamor, no crowding.

Several dozen grotesquely shaped Source Stones lay scattered across white jade platforms. Some resembled vicious ghosts claiming lives, while others looked like severed limbs. Every stone was covered in dark-red patterns like bloodstains dried for ten thousand years.

Every stone that emerged from the Primordial Ancient Mine was tainted with misfortune.

Ordinary cultivators who came within thirty feet would feel their blood and qi flow backward, their minds flooded with illusions.

"So these are Primordial Source Stones..."

Cold sweat beaded on Zuo Tianhe's forehead. The Killing Intent here was too heavy; even as a Golden Core cultivator, he felt tightness in his chest and shortness of breath.

Violet-gold light flowed through Ye Xingchen's eyes.

In his vision, how was this a stone-gambling arena?

It was clearly a field of Asura hell!

Within every Source Stone were sealed fragments of time. Some contained black mist that towered to the heavens—peerless fiendish beings. Some held countless strands of auspicious radiance—rare treasures beyond price.

But even more contained killing intent.

The Shen Clan members had arrived as well.

The black-robed man seemed deeply wary after suffering that hidden loss earlier. He kept far away from Ye Xingchen and walked directly toward a black boulder half a man tall. Stretching out his withered claw, he gently stroked the stone skin, his nails scraping across it with a piercing screech.

Zhang Sanqian, Gu He, and the Sky-Eye Daoist also scattered, each employing their own methods to inspect the Source Stones.

Only Ye Xingchen kept his hands behind his back, wandering about like an idle fellow at a marketplace, looking here and there without the slightest air of a master.

"Putting on airs and playing tricks."

Zhang Sanqian glanced at him and sneered. "Boy, the stones in the Primordial Zone all carry Killing Intent. If you poke around without knowing what you're doing, be careful not to ruin your hand. If you're scared now, kneel and kowtow three times, and perhaps this old man will..."

"Master Zhang."

Ye Xingchen suddenly interrupted him.

"Since you're so concerned about me, how about I give you a meeting gift in return?"

"Hm...?" Zhang Sanqian froze.

Ye Xingchen had stopped before a stone in the corner.

This stone was only the size of a watermelon, grayish-white all over and covered in spiderweb-like cracks. It looked like a piece of weathered scrap that had sat for years, the sort no one would bother picking up even if it were thrown by the roadside.

Yet as Ye Xingchen looked at it, an exceedingly dangerous gleam flashed through his eyes.

He pointed at the stone, a dazzlingly bright smile blooming across his face. His voice was not loud, yet it carried clearly through the entire venue.

"This is the stone I'm giving you."

He stared at Zhang Sanqian, his tone exceedingly gentle and utterly sincere.

"But it depends on whether Master dares to cut it!"
